Hi all

Has anyone had the GVN60 Kenwood Sat nav installed? If so do you know where it is located under the dashboard. I know it's under it somewhere but can't find it to do a firmware update on.

Any advice appreciated.

It is probably at the rear of the glove box,you will have to reposition it to get at the sd card slot,suggest you fix it to the underside of the glove box with Velcro it will make things easier for the next time you need to get at it.

The plot thickens, Garmin tell me that an update is available: City Navigator® Europe NTU 2017-Kenwood MSD
Kenwood acknowledge this but say it is not available online. I contacted my local Kenwood Dealer - he hasn't got it and can't get it!

Garmin also tell me "This is the last available mapping for your device."

The device is only 18 months old but the maps can't be updated. I feel it was sold under false pretences.
